About the airport

Bajhang Airport (IATA code: BJH, ICAO code: VNBG) is a small domestic airport located in the Bajhang district of Nepal. Situated at an elevation of 1,670 meters (5,479 feet) above sea level, this airport serves as a gateway to the beautiful Bajhang region.

The airport has a single asphalt runway measuring 600 meters (1,969 feet) in length, which can accommodate small aircraft like Dornier Do 228 and Let L-410 Turbolet. It is operated by the Civil Aviation Authority of Nepal and primarily serves as a connection point for travelers visiting Bajhang for tourism, business, or religious purposes.

Facilities at Bajhang Airport are limited but sufficient for the convenience of travelers. There is a small terminal building with basic amenities, including a waiting area and restroom facilities. However, it is advisable to carry essential supplies and provisions as there are limited services available in the vicinity of the airport.
